ANTIQUE DOLL HOUSE WALTERSHAUSEN FURNITURE & ACCESSORIES. Circa 1900. Waltershausen (Boulle) furniture includes an extremely rare sideboard with bone finials mounted between the shelves with an elaborate center cabinet having glass door, lined with blue paper on door and sides. This lovely dining room piece has a long center drawer and flanking cabinets below. Included in the lot is a marble turtle top table mounted on a pedestal base, a bust of Queen Victoria mounted on a black pedestal, an ormolu fireplace with tall pier mirror complete with fender below having a matching coal hog, an ormolu lamp with Bristol shade and three gold ormolu framed prints. SIZE: Tallest is 7-3/4″. PROVENANCE: From the Estate of Geraldine Gaba, Scottsdale, AZ. CONDITION: Good. The Queen Victoria bust has been reglued on pedestal base.
